On consent the Portage City Council approved final plans for Stanwood Crossings (40 single-family units) and Creekside (46 rental units), renewed its five-year weed treatment resolution and, after closed session, voted to authorize the city manager on an unspecified matter.

Portage — At its Feb. 25 meeting the Portage City Council approved several items on the consent agenda and took a follow-up vote after a closed session.

On a consent agenda vote earlier in the meeting, the council approved the final plan for a 40-unit single-family development at Stanwood Crossings and the final plan for a 46-unit rental housing development at Creekside. The council also passed a five-year renewal of the city’s weed-treatment program, a recurring resolution the council said has been in effect since 1988 and is renewed every five years.
